Automatic registration of retina images based on genetic techniques

G. Troglio; Jon Atli Benediktsson; Sebastiano B. Serpico; Gabriele Moser; R. A. Karlsson; Gisli Hreinn Halldorsson; Einar Stefánsson

The aim of this paper is to develop an automatic method for the registration of multitemporal digital images of the fundus of the human retina. The images are acquired from the same patient at different times by a color fundus camera. The proposed approach is based on the application of global optimization techniques to previously extracted maps of curvilinear structures in the images to be registered (such structures being represented by the vessels in the human retina): in particular, a genetic algorithm is used, in order to estimate the optimum transformation between the input and the base image. The algorithm is tested on two different types of data, gray scale and color images, and for both types, images with small changes and with large changes are used. The comparison between the registered images using the implemented method and a manual one points out that the proposed algorithm provides an accurate registration. The convergence to a solution is not possible only when dealing with images taken from very different view-points.

Automatic Retinal Oximetry

Gisli Hreinn Halldorsson; R. A. Karlsson; Sveinn Hakon Hardarson; M. Dalla Mura; Thor Eysteinsson; James M. Beach; Einar Stefánsson; Jon Atli Benediktsson

PURPOSE To measure hemoglobin oxygen saturation (SO(2)) in retinal vessels and to test the reproducibility and sensitivity of an automatic spectrophotometric oximeter. METHODS Specialized software automatically identifies the retinal blood vessels on fundus images, which are obtained with four different wavelengths of light. The software calculates optical density ratios (ODRs) for each vessel. The reproducibility was evaluated by analyzing five repeated measurements of the same vessels. A linear relationship between SO(2) and ODR was assumed and a linear model derived. After calibration, reproducibility and sensitivity were calculated in terms of SO(2). Systemic hyperoxia (n = 16) was induced in healthy volunteers by changing the O(2) concentration in inhaled air from 21% to 100%. RESULTS The automatic software enhanced reproducibility, and the mean SD for repeated measurements was 3.7% for arterioles and 5.3% venules, in terms of percentage of SO(2) (five repeats, 10 individuals). The model derived for calibration was SO(2) = 125 - 142 . ODR. The arterial SO(2) measured 96% +/- 9% (mean +/- SD) during normoxia and 101% +/- 8% during hyperoxia (n = 16). The difference between normoxia and hyperoxia was significant (P = 0.0027, paired t-test). Corresponding numbers for venules were 55% +/- 14% and 78% +/- 15% (P < 0.0001). SO(2) is displayed as a pseudocolor map drawn on fundus images. CONCLUSIONS The retinal oximeter is reliable, easy to use, and sensitive to changes in SO(2) when concentration of O(2) in inhaled air is changed.
